Output 8580cc6e2e200cb446b854c1baf690f38346f65b74d7a1630f24dd5c9cc217c7:1

value
19682920552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ee69b064ca381e1b4e2fd8c74d0f6bb8c15a9c8a OP_EQUAL
address
3PRdMbu2ErNmX7k32HKty1VFfvDY4SDRxD
transaction
8580cc6e2e200cb446b854c1baf690f38346f65b74d7a1630f24dd5c9cc217c7
spent
true